Population and land area for Trois-Rivières
Statistics Canada gives Trois-Rivières a population of 139,163 in the 2021 Census. Trois-Rivières covers 288.6 square kilometres of land.
Trois-Rivières therefore has a calculated density of 482.1 people per square kilometre.
Trois-Rivières ranks 9 by population among the covered places in Quebec.

Provincial rules for Trois-Rivières borrowers
A lender dealing with a Trois-Rivières resident holds a licence issued under Quebec consumer credit law, and that licence is the first thing a borrower can check.
The payday position recorded for Quebec is part of the same framework, and it applies in Trois-Rivières as it does across the province: Quebec does not license payday lending, which effectively prohibits the model in the province. No provincial payday cap is published; confirm the position with the provincial regulator.

Cost and repayment for a emergency loan in Trois-Rivières
The price of a emergency loan in Trois-Rivières comes from the lender's own assessment, and the disclosure statement sets out the interest and any fees before the contract is signed.
In Trois-Rivières, the borrower's own check on a emergency loan is to compare the cost against the consequence of waiting, because an urgent price is often a high one.
Prepayment terms vary between contracts, and a Trois-Rivières borrower who may pay early can check whether a charge applies.
